Introduction

What is evaporator

 An evaporator  is a device used to turn the liquid form of a chemical into its gaseous form. The liquidis evaporated, or vaporized, into a gas.

Figure 1: Schematic diagram of evaporator

 Evaporation is a special case of heat transfer to a boiling liquid. This particular heattransfer application is so common and important that it is treated as a separate unit

operation.

The intent is to concentrate a non-volatile solute from a solvent, usually water. This is

done by boiling off the solvent. Concentration by evaporation is normally stopped

 before the solute begins to precipitate; if not, the operation is better considered

as crystallization.

Evaporation is usually treated as the separation of a liquid mixture into a liquid product concentrate or thick liquor ! and a vapor byproduct, although in special cases

such as water treating and desalination, the vapor is the product instead of the thic"

liquor.

atural Circulation evaporators

In Natural Circulation evaporators, short vertical tubes, typically 1-2 m long and 50- 100 mm in

diameter, are arranged inside the tubes, and the product is concentrated. The concentrated liquid

falls back to the base of the vessel through a central annular section. A shell-and-tube heat

exchanger can be provided outside the main evaporation vessel to preheat the liquid feed. The most

common application for this type of unit is as a reboiler at the base of a distillation column. νNatural

Forced Circulation &vaporator

Forced Circulation Evaporator The forced circulation evaporator was developed for processing

liquors which are susceptible to scaling or crystallizing. Liquid is circulated at a high rate through the

heat exchanger, boiling being prevented within the unit by virtue of a hydrostatic head maintained

above the top tube plate. As the liquid enters the separator where the absolute pressure is slightlyless than in the tube bundle, the liquid flashes to form a vapor.

Batch pan Evaporators

Batch pan Evaporators The batch pan evaporator is one of the simplest and oldest types of

evaporators used in food industry. Now-a-days it is outdated technology, but it still used in a few

limited applications, such as the concentration of jams and jellies where whole fruit is present and in

processing some pharmaceutical products. Up until the early 1960's, batch pan also enjoyed wideuse in the concentration of corn syrups. In batch pan evaporator the product is heated in a steam

 jacketed spherical vessel. The heating vessel may be open to the atmosphere or connected to the

condenser and vacuum. The heat transfer area per unit volume is in batch pan evaporator is small.

Thus, the residence time normally is many hours. Therefore, it is essential to boil at low

temperatures and high vacuum when a heat sensitive or thermo degradable product is involved.

(ising ;lm &vaporator

Rising-film Evaporators These are considered to be the first 'modern' evaporator used in the industry,

the rising film unit dates back to the early 1900's. The rising film principle was developed

commercially by using a vertical tube heated from the outside with steam. Liquid on the inside of the

tube is brought to a boil, with the vapor generated forming a core in the center of the tube. As thefluid moves up the tube, more vapors are formed resulting in a higher central core velocity those

forces the remaining liquid to the tube wall.

Falling Film &vaporator

Falling-Film Evaporators The falling-film evaporators has a thin liquid film moving downward under

gravity on the inside of the vertical tubes. The design of such evaporators is complicated by the fact

that distribution of liquid in a uniform film flowing downward in a tube is more difficult to obtain than

an upward-flow system such as in a rising- film evaporator. This is accomplished by the use of

specially designed distribution or spray nozzles. The falling-film evaporators allow a greater number

of effects then the rising-film evaporator. The falling-film evaporator can handle more viscous liquids

than the rising film type. This type of evaporators is best suited for highly heat sensitive products

such as orange juice

(ising<Falling &vaporator

Rising/Falling Evaporator In the rising/falling evaporator, the product is concentrated by circulation

through a rising-film section followed by a falling-film section of the evaporator. The product is first

concentrated as it ascends through a rising tube section, followed by pre concentrated product

descending through a falling-film section, there it attains its final concentration.
